Starting the fire from embers requires the right amount of good kindling and patience. The first layer of dried leaves and then small twigs was built upon with progressively larger twigs in the form of a teepee.
A few minutes after the first layer went down, whiffs of smoke began rising and I knew it was only a matter of time before we had a good fire.
Now that is roaring! We'll let it settle a bit, spread it out and put some heavier logs on to cook with.
